How to Prompt AI for a Surprised Cartoon Face
- Build the Expression: Specify wide eyes, iris or pupil size, eyebrow height, mouth shape, and whether the surprise feels delighted, confused, shocked, or frightened.
- Choose a Cartoon Language: Name concrete traits such as thick comic outlines, kawaii proportions, anime cel shading, flat vector shapes, or glossy 3D materials.
- Protect the Silhouette: Ask for a centered head-and-shoulders close-up with the hair, eyebrows, chin, and open mouth fully inside the frame, especially for a square avatar or sticker.
- Refine One Cue at a Time: Use Chat Edit to raise the brows, reduce fear, enlarge the eyes, simplify the background, or keep the same character while testing a different reaction intensity.
Surprised Cartoon Face Prompts for Every Style
Comic Meme Reaction: Create a square 2D cartoon shocked face with huge round eyes, tiny pupils, raised eyebrows, and a wide O-shaped mouth. Use thick black ink, vivid primary colors, halftone dots, and explosive surprise lines. Center the face for a meme reaction image; no text.
Cute Sticker: Draw a cute surprised face cartoon of an original chibi character with sparkling oversized eyes, blush dots, soft curved brows, and a tiny round mouth. Use pastel pink, cream, and lavender with clean sticker-like edges and a minimal background.
Anime Close-Up: Generate an anime surprised face in a square close-up. Show wide luminous eyes, small pupils, sharply lifted brows, a slightly open mouth, crisp cel shading, and blue-pink speed lines. Keep the emotion amazed rather than afraid.
Glossy 3D Avatar: Create a polished 3D cartoon reaction face with enlarged eyes, high brows, and a rounded open mouth. Use smooth clay-like materials, soft studio lighting, orange and cyan accents, and a simple gradient background for a profile avatar.
Photo to Cartoon Surprise: Turn my uploaded portrait into a colorful 2D cartoon with a playful surprised expression. Keep the hairstyle, glasses, face shape, and outfit recognizable; change the eyes, eyebrows, and mouth to show delighted shock. Use a clean square composition.
Character Reaction Sheet: Create a consistent four-panel expression sheet for one original cartoon character: subtle surprise, delighted surprise, comic shock, and speechless amazement. Keep the same head shape, hairstyle, outfit, palette, line style, and front-facing crop in every panel.
